Detailed Review

The Polar Loop is a minimalist, screen-free fitness band from Polar, perfect for health-conscious individuals who prioritize accurate tracking without the buzz of notifications or screens. It targets users focused on sleep quality, recovery, heart rate monitoring, and daily activity, especially those tired of subscription-based wearables like Whoop. With Polar's sports science heritage, it delivers insights through the free Polar Flow app.

Key features shine in real-world use: 24/7 optical heart rate via Precision Prime sensor, automatic training detection, and advanced sleep tools like Nightly Recharge for circadian rhythm analysis. Reviews highlight excellent sleep accuracy for optimizing rest, though some note it overcounts steps or calories and struggles to differentiate casual activity from workouts. App integration provides detailed feedback without extra costs, earning praise from loyal Polar fans upgrading from chest straps.

Design emphasizes comfort with a 29g weight, soft fabric band, and customizable colors for discreet 24/7 wear, including sleep. WR30 water resistance and USB-C charging support active routines, while Bluetooth 5.1 ensures reliable syncing. Build quality feels premium, but the velcro fastener deteriorates fast for some.

Drawbacks include variable battery life closer to 3 days for intensive tracking, inconsistent auto-sync, and less intuitive activity categorization. These issues frustrate precise users but do not overshadow the no-fee value.

Overall, Polar Loop excels as a subscription-free alternative for distraction-free monitoring. Buy it if you value Polar's accuracy and simplicity over flashy displays; consider alternatives if flawless syncing is essential.

Specifications

Key Specs:

  • Weight: 29 Grams
  • Battery Life: Up to 8 days (Lithium-Ion, USB-C charging)
  • Water Resistance: WR30
  • Sensor: Optical heart rate (Precision Prime)
  • Compatibility: Smartphones, tablets, laptops via Polar Flow app
  • Size: S-L (2 wristbands included)
  • Material: Customizable fabric wristband, plastic sensor
  • Connectivity: Bluetooth 5.1
  • Warranty: 2 Years
  • Included: Sensor unit, charging cable, quick start guide
